Join our team as Health and Safety Advisor!

Chester Race Company is delighted to offer an excellent opportunity for a dedicated professional to join our Health and Safety team as a Health and Safety Advisor. This permanent position, based in the heart of Chester, plays a key role in supporting the development and delivery of a robust, company‑wide health and safety management system.

Reporting directly to the Head of Health and Safety, the successful candidate will demonstrate initiative, strong problem‑solving abilities, and excellent interpersonal skills to address and communicate safety matters effectively across the business.

This position is vital in upholding the highest standards of safety, ensuring a secure environment for our employees, guests, and wider stakeholder community.

General Responsibilities
  • Support in the development and implementation of a health and safety management system, ensuring that policies, procedures and guidelines are effectively communicated to all employees
  • Ensure effective document control procedures and quality assurance
  • Participate in regular health and safety committee meetings, documenting actions and following up on any outstanding tasks or issues
  • Deputise for the Head of Health and Safety in their absence and share duties on race and event days
  • Foster a positive safety culture by engaging employees in safety initiatives, encouraging active participation in safety committees and meetings
  • Challenge unsafe behaviours, including non‑compliance with health and safety processes and protocols
  • Investigate all minor incidents, claims and complaints, ensuring thorough investigation, appropriate action and timely resolution with necessary changes put in place
  • Assist in tracking operational KPIs and measuring incident rates against the national average
  • Support the development and delivery of training programs to enhance employee knowledge and maintain a training matrix to identify and address skills gaps
  • Stay up to date with new legislation and maintain a working knowledge of all developments affecting the racing and events industry
  • Coordinate with external service providers to ensure their adherence to health and safety protocols and integrate their processes into the wider system
  • Monitor and evaluate contractor performance through regular engagement via inspections and audits, addressing any issues that arise
  • Assist in organising workplace health and safety tours, visits, and observations by company leaders to improve visibility and engagement
  • Provide health and safety response during race days, including coordinating medical incidents, and collecting incident data to feedback
  • Conduct pre‑event inspections, briefings and event risk assessments to ensure the site is in a safe condition, logging and resolving any issues before the event begins
Key Requirements
  • Previous experience within a Health and Safety position
  • Proven experience in supporting and delivering health and safety management systems, including risk assessments and safety procedures
  • Experience in site inspections, managing incidents and identifying hazards, with the ability to implement appropriate control measures
  • Knowledge and understanding of health and safety legislation, regulations and best practices
  • NEBOSH General Certificate qualification in occupational health and safety is mandatory
  • Qualification in Level 4 Spectator Safety Management is desirable
  • Qualification in ISO 9001 Internal Auditor is desirable
About Chester Race Company

Chester Race Company Ltd is one of the North West’s best‑known and most‑admired brands. It is an evolving organisation with a broad portfolio but retaining Horse racing at its core. The Company operates three racecourses, Chester, Bangor‑on‑Dee and Musselburgh, in Scotland. At Chester, we also own and operate a hotel, a vibrant pub and have in the city. Not to mention our in‑house caterers, Horseradish and our staffing brand – Thyme People.

With that much diversity in our business, no two days are the same.
